baypole screws are a versatile and essential component in various construction projects. These specialized screws are designed to securely fasten bay windows, conservatories, and other large window structures to the building. Their unique design and construction make them an ideal choice for ensuring the structural integrity and longevity of these structures.
One of the key features of baypole screws is their self-drilling capabilities. Unlike traditional screws that require a pilot hole to be drilled before installation, baypole screws have a sharp point that allows them to penetrate the frame material easily. This not only saves time during the installation process but also reduces the risk of damaging the frame material.
In addition to their self-drilling capabilities, baypole screws also have a unique thread design that provides superior grip and holding power. The threads are specially designed to create a tight seal between the screw and the frame material, preventing the screw from loosening over time. This ensures that the bay window or conservatory remains securely attached to the building even in the face of strong winds or other external forces.
Furthermore, baypole screws are made from high-quality materials such as stainless steel or zinc-plated steel. This not only makes them durable and long-lasting but also resistant to corrosion and rust. This is especially important for outdoor applications where the screws are exposed to the elements and harsh weather conditions.
Another advantage of baypole screws is their versatility in terms of size and length. They are available in a variety of sizes and lengths to accommodate different frame thicknesses and materials. Whether you are working with PVC, aluminum, or timber frames, there is a baypole screw size that is suitable for your specific application.
Furthermore, baypole screws come with a variety of head types to choose from, including pan head, countersunk head, and hex head. This allows for greater flexibility in installation and ensures a seamless and professional finish to the project. The different head types also provide options for different aesthetic preferences or functional requirements.
In addition to their functionality and durability, baypole screws are also easy to install. With a power drill and the appropriate screwdriver bit, the screws can be quickly and easily driven into the frame material without the need for special tools or equipment. This makes them a cost-effective solution for both DIY enthusiasts and professional contractors alike.
